Transaction 43febaea17e8463f0efeb0793533d7cbf11d5a24d4ae5f684ba4dd96395ae9ca

1 Input
2 Outputs
  • 43febaea17e8463f0efeb0793533d7cbf11d5a24d4ae5f684ba4dd96395ae9ca:0
  • value  435700000
    address  3DSh8EbNuvoM4L9pacKYaWm1NXGDnbR75U
  • 43febaea17e8463f0efeb0793533d7cbf11d5a24d4ae5f684ba4dd96395ae9ca:1
  • value  4789808130
    address  14VcdeTkmEGCcLkcJ3oRTwCmzi1ekePEYd